Did you get LVM-related >> errors that I may not be considering? :) >> >> -Barnaby >> > > I had this problem earlier. The issue ended up being the same: I > forgot to create GPT labels for the partitions. I had 2x4TB arrays I > needed to span into a single 8TB array for several systems. The steps > I use when making these LVM partition are as follows: > > parted /dev/sdb > mklabel gpt > mkpart > primary > xfs > 0 > 4196049 > select /dev/sdc > mklabel gpt > mkpart > primary > xfs > 0 > 4196049 > quit > > At the shell, type: > > pvcreate --metadatasize 1M /dev/sd{b,c}1 > vgcreate -s 128M vg0 /dev/sd[bc]1 > lvcreate -n lv0 -L8T vg0 > mkfs.xfs /dev/vg0/lv0 > > The sizes are arbitrary numbers that I got while playing around with > them and are the first ones that actually worked without whining at me > about metadata sizes when creating the logical volume. Dan, LVM > doesn't really care about the partition label. You should be able to > do what I did above (but then with ReiserFS) to get what you need. > > With standard DOS partitions this will not work, as they only support > 2^32-1 bytes. > > --Devon > > >> Dan wrote: >> >>> It was indeed a partition problem. Thanks. fdisk does not support >>> partitions over 2TB so I had to use GNU Parted to setup the partition >>> with a GPT label that supports over 2TB. I could then create reiserfs >>> filesystems and got two 4.6TB partitions. Unfortunately Parted and >>> GPT do not support LVM so I could not raid the two partitions into one >>> giant one unless I am missing something.
